Field Reduction Electrodes for the Possible Improvement in the Pollution Flashover Performance of Porcelain Insulators
In this paper an attempt is made to study accurately, the field distribution for various types of porcelain/ceramic insulators used for high voltage transmission. The surface charge simulation method is employed for the field computation. Novel field reduction electrodes are developed to reduce the maximum field around the pin region. In order to experimentally scrutinize the performance of discs with field reduction electrodes, special artificial pollution test facility was built and utilized. The experimental results show better improvement in the pollution flashover performance of string insulators.
